Building Materials

Learning outcomes

  • professional knowledge
    • can describe the basic physical and mechanical properties of basic types of building materials,
    • remembers the basic physical and mechanical properties, specifics, advantages and disadvantages of individual materials,
    • remembers the basic principles of the technology of production, processing and finalization of materials and products,
    • can give examples of the use of selected materials in practice,
    • can reproduce basic technical data and principles of determining the properties of materials,
    • knows the basic principles of work in a laboratory environment,
  • professional skills
    • can work with basic measuring instruments for determining dimensions, volume and weight in a laboratory environment,
    • can process measured data in the form of a measurement report,
    • can assess the compliance of the determined results with normative regulations or technical sheets,
    • can determine the basic physical and mechanical properties of building materials by calculation based on the specified inputs,
    • can use theoretical and practical knowledge at a basic level for real application in construction (assessment of the compatibility of building materials when combining them, suitability for use in a given environment, calculation of self-weight, volume, transportation of materials, load-bearing capacity, etc.),
